Rails for conveying oriented parts are always built on order, so as to suit
the dimensions of the items being conveyed.
Almost all standard troughs are manufactured from stainless steel and are
polished electrochemically. In some cases the trough are made up of synthetic
materials or light alloys. If trough lonings are required, a range of
different materials is available to meet the requirements of individual
installations.
If customers make their own conveying attachments (trough rail etc.) they
should ensure that it is suffciently strong to withstand the vibration. Long
lengths, low side-walls without increased mechanical stiffness, thin sheet
metal, or excessive widths without reinforcing struts should be avoided.
